CVE-2023-1371 is a medium-severity vulnerability affecting the W4 Post List WordPress plugin prior to version 2.4.6. It allows any authenticated user to bypass password protection and access the content of protected posts due to insufficient access control. The vulnerability has a CVSS score of 6.5, indicating a network attack vector with low complexity and a high impact on confidentiality. There is currently no evidence of active exploitation, public exploit code, or significant community discussion surrounding this CVE.
